Checking of Electrolyte, Glue or Gap Filler Dispensing Heads

High-throughput dispensing applications are common in the battery industry for delivering electrolyte, gap fillers or glue. Dispensing heads must be metrologically controlled and adjusted according to the ambient conditions, density, or viscosity of the delivered liquids.

Dosing of Slurry Constituents

Strict compliance to the slurry recipe is critical to ensuring perfect adhesion of the coating to the electrode foils and, therefore, extended battery life. However, variations in composition of both pure and recycled raw materials are inevitable across different batches, or suppliers.

Sartorius’ integrated weigh cells are ideal for gravimetric measurement of deviation from the target value of each component, and guiding the reformulation of slurry recipes.

Control of Correct Assembly

Embedding weighing steps strategically along your battery production can detect missing components, ensure accurate dispensing, and enable perfect assembly of all systems, from stacking to module assembly.

In-line weighing controls identify deviations right when they happen, with high precision, allowing checking of 100% of products. Measurement accuracy can be adjusted to the product and the measurement time can be optimized using the integrated digital filter.
